UK to send warships to Indian Ocean as sign of close strategic ties with India: Defence Secy Shapps

London: The UK authorities on Wednesday unveiled plans to deploy Royal Navy warships to the Indian Ocean area later this yr to function and practice with Indian forces, signalling what it described because the rising significance of the strategic relationship between the 2 nations. Defence Secretary Grant Shapps, who co-chaired an India-UK Defence Trade CEOs Roundtable with visiting Defence Minister Rajnath Singh on Wednesday following their bilateral talks earlier, mentioned the Littoral Response Group (LRG) shall be deployed this yr and the Provider Strike Group (CRG) in 2025 for joint India-UK coaching.

The deployment of the UK’s “most superior naval capabilities” has been flagged by the UK Ministry of Defence (MoD) as a “decisive step” in bolstering UK-India safety ties.

“There’s completely no query that the world is changing into more and more contested, so it is important that we proceed to construct on our strategic relationships with key companions like India,” mentioned Shapps. “Collectively, we share the identical safety challenges and are steadfast in our dedication to sustaining a free and affluent Indo-Pacific. It’s clear that this relationship goes from energy to energy, however we should proceed to work hand-in-hand to uphold world safety in gentle of threats and challenges that search to destabilise and injury us,” he mentioned.

The LRG is a Royal Navy process group consisting of at the very least two amphibious warfare ships, and the CRG is the plane service battle group of the Royal Navy. The CRG’s inaugural deployment was again in 2021 within the Indo-Pacific, the place it carried out joint workout routines with the Indian forces.

“Had an exquisite interplay with the business leaders and CEOs on the UK-India Defence CEO Roundtable in London,” Defence Minister Singh posted on social media platform X after the convention. “India envisions an enriching partnership with the UK to cooperate, co-create and co-innovate. By synergising the strengths of each the nations, we will do nice issues collectively,” he mentioned. The MoD mentioned the most recent deployment displays a stepped-up partnership through the Indian Defence Minister’s first go to to the UK this week.

“Within the coming years, the UK and India may even embark on extra complicated workout routines between their respective militaries, constructing as much as a landmark joint train to be carried out earlier than the tip of 2030, supporting shared objectives of defending crucial commerce routes and upholding the worldwide rules-based system,” the MoD mentioned.

The talks between the 2 senior ministers mentioned future cooperation in defence, from joint workout routines to information sharing and teacher exchanges, which construct on the great strategic partnership envisaged within the 2030 India-UK Roadmap.

On the CEOs Roundtable, collaboration with business was in focus, with the 2 nations working collectively on electrical propulsion techniques that may energy future fleets and cooperating on the event of complicated weapons.

Constructing on the prevailing strategic partnership, some new joint initiatives highlighted by the MoD throughout Singh’s UK go to embody Launching Defence Partnership-India, a bespoke workplace designed to additional defence collaboration between the 2 nations; a dedication to a number of teacher exchanges between UK Officer Coaching Faculties and specialist faculties, alongside a Youth Alternate MOU to solidify the already robust relationship between our cadet organisations.

Different initiatives embody, a Letter of Association that may allow additional emphasis to be positioned on analysis and improvement between our two nations, targeted on next-generation capabilities; and “solidifying” an settlement on logistics alternate, permitting for the availability of logistic help, provides and companies between the UK and Indian Armed Forces, for joint coaching, joint workout routines, authorised port visits and Humanitarian Help and Catastrophe Aid (HADR) operations.

Singh arrived in London on Monday and has held a sequence of engagements apart from bilateral talks along with his UK counterpart. He’ll interact with the Indian group at a diaspora reception to conclude his official go to on Wednesday night.
